Narrow-profile cog recommendation(?)
 
Hi. As a first, fixed gear project, I'm converting an older 80s bike. I am trying to put a 16T cog on a threaded freewheel hub and I'm running out of threads for the lock ring (re-purposed BB lock ring). I can start the threads for the lock ring (maybe a thread and a half), but there aren't nearly enough to fully-engage the lock ring and tightening the ring will probably just strip the threads. The 3/32"-16T origin8 cog that I am bought is 7.3 mm wide. Can anyone recommend a threaded cog with a narrower profile (that would leave more threads exposed for a lock ring) that I could substitute? I plan to use thread locker on the cog and a front brake, but I am not experienced enough to judge whether I can overlook a lock ring with this setup. Does anyone with more experience have an opinion? Add a rear brake and a mouth guard? Thanks in advance.

ThermionicScott 06-20-19 09:43 AM

I only have two freewheel hubs in my collection, but it was the same situation with them, only about 1 thread left after a cog went on. If my hubs were threaded all the way to the end, there might be enough for a BB lockring, but they're stepped down to an unthreaded section for the outer 1mm or so. Not sure if that's common or not.

If you're concerned, buy or build a wheel with a proper track hub. It's among the easiest wheels to build. :thumb:

JohnDThompson 03-04-20 07:51 PM

I just tried a bunch of cogs (SunTour, Dura-Ace, Euro-Asia, etc.) on a Campagnolo Record road hub and the only two that offered more than a thread or so of engagement for a lockring were both long out of production: an early 1950s Sturmey-Archer cog from before they adopted the splined cogs, and another marked "Reich."

N.B. if you're going to run a fixed gear on a road hub, lockring or not, keep the rear brake and don't use your legs for slowing down or stopping.

For practical road fix gears, older road bikes with horizontal dropouts are the sweet deal. Derailleur hangers don't matter. I go out of my way to find early '80s horizontally dropped bikes using the standards the Japanese used. (English tube diameters and frame threading, metric elsewhere.)

Road dropouts mean you can use a rear brake and have little rim height change if you change cogs and have the wheel a little further forward or back. Road dropouts also make pulling and installing the rear wheel a lot faster; a real blessing if you have to fix a flat in the dark. That all road fix gears marketed now have track ends says a lot about both marketing and peer pressure.
